The National Book Trust (NBT) of India has showcased a prestigious replica of the original handwritten Indian Constitution manuscript at the 43rd Sharjah International Book Fair (SIBF). The exhibit is part of India’s comprehensive literary showcase at the event, which runs from November 6 to 17. This A3-sized copy of the Constitution of India is certified by the Lok Sabha Secretariat and features superior quality and clarity in the presentation of Acts and Stanzas.

Among NBT’s featured collections are the PM-YUVA series, highlighting India’s Freedom Movement and Knowledge Systems, alongside the Indian@75 series.

India’s presence at SIBF is substantial with 52 major publishers participating. The UAE leads Arab participation with 234 publishers and the United Kingdom leads international participation with 81 publishers. The 43rd edition brings together an impressive array of literary figures, including 49 international speakers from 14 nations among a distinguished assembly of 134 guests.

Morocco, this year’s Guest of Honour, showcased its rich literary and cultural legacy at the event organized by the Sharjah Book Authority. The SIBF 2024 features more than 400 authors and hosts 600 workshops for all age groups, including exclusive pre-booked sessions led by leading global experts in creative writing. The event will conclude on November 17th.
